A new medicinal toothpaste, Pell-Nicole, formulated with sulfurous mud extract, demonstrates effective antimicrobial and anti-inflammatory properties. This natural toothpaste is recommended for various gum conditions and overall dental hygiene.

Area of Science:

  • Oral Health
  • Material Science
  • Pharmacology

Background:

  • Natural organic-mineral complexes, like sulfurous mud, offer potential therapeutic benefits.
  • Development of novel dental hygiene products is crucial for managing oral health issues.
  • Existing dental products may not fully address specific periodontal conditions.

Purpose of the Study:

  • To formulate and characterize a medicinal toothpaste using an atomized extract of Nicolina Iassy sulfurous mud.
  • To evaluate the physico-chemical properties and therapeutic effects of the novel toothpaste.
  • To assess the suitability of the toothpaste for treating gum affections and promoting dental hygiene.

Main Methods:

  • Formulation of a medicinal toothpaste incorporating an atomized sulfurous mud extract.

  • Physico-chemical characterization including aspect, pH, abrasion value, and rheological properties.
  • Evaluation of therapeutic effects, specifically antimicrobial and anti-inflammatory actions.
  • Main Results:

    • The optimal toothpaste formula (Pell-Nicole) was identified with specific physical and chemical parameters.
    • Rheological measurements indicated plastic behavior with thixotropic character, ensuring stability and firmness.
    • Demonstrated significant antimicrobial and anti-inflammatory effects in preliminary testing.

    Conclusions:

    • The Pell-Nicole toothpaste, derived from natural sulfurous mud, exhibits favorable physico-chemical and therapeutic properties.
    • Its stability, firmness, and demonstrated efficacy make it a promising option for oral care.
    • Recommended for treating gum affections, periodontopathies, and maintaining general dental hygiene.
